Trade 1 of 2

Kansas City Chiefs and Los Angeles Rams

Even Trade Tier: standard Confidence: medium

Kansas City sent All-Pro cornerback Trent McDuffie to Los Angeles and received the No. 29 pick in the 2026 draft, 2026 fifth- and sixth-round picks, and a 2027 third-round choice. The first-rounder became Peter Woods, while the later 2026 picks were subsequently moved to Pittsburgh. The Chiefs obtained substantial draft capital, but no regular-season results from the new assets exist yet, so the current grade remains provisional.

Trade 2 of 2

Pittsburgh Steelers and Kansas City Chiefs

Even Trade Tier: standard Confidence: medium

Pittsburgh sent Kansas City picks No. 161 and No. 249 in the 2026 draft and received No. 169 plus No. 210. The Steelers used those incoming selections on Riley Nowakowski and Gabriel Rubio. Pittsburgh moved down eight spots in the fifth round to add a sixth-round choice, a reasonable two-for-two reshaping of late capital. With no regular-season results yet, the prior Steelers-win label is too early and an Even Trade fits better.
